I have several sites that offer referral commission to their members. However, one common issues we encounter is finding them and sometimes, when we find one, they are not as active as we want them to be. There may be some valid reasons reasons for their inactivity and on of that is that we were not able to guide them well.
I have sites where I have hundreds of referrals and some with just a few. But what I noticed is with one of my sites where I was not very active lately because of my day job. When I checked my earnings, I noticed a continuous increase on a daily basis and when I checked my earning activities, it shows that I am earning well from my referrals.
What are your strategies to keep your referrals active and enthusiastic?
